我对C#编程比较陌生,所以我决定通过尝试一些基本的编程任务来自我发展。其中一个就是计算器,我几乎已经破解了它,除了我希望计算器在计算之前首先接受所有的值 - 不像我在网上看过的那些很多,其中计算前两个值,然后用这两个值的结果计算第三个值。
我的想法是在编译时只声明一个变量,然后每当用户点击一个运算符时,就会创建一个新变量来接受之后传入的值。在接受所有值并单击等号按钮之前,不会进行任何计算。
有什么想法吗?
答案 0 :(得分:0)
到目前为止,我得到了你的问题..你应该保留值和运算符的集合。你需要对值和运算符或分隔符进行单一集合以及维护堆栈格式或队列,这完全取决于你。 / p>
这里的集合可以是任何东西。像列表,数组等..